Neuralink’s First Patient Becomes a Gaming Prodigy

Noland Arbaugh’s tale is one for the cyberpunk annals. Earlier this year, the 29-year-old took a leap into the future by becoming the first patient to receive a brain-computer chip implanted by Elon Musk’s avant-garde startup, Neuralink. A diving accident eight years ago left Arbaugh with limited control over his limbs, but this cutting-edge device, no larger than a coin battery, has given him a new lease on life. By implanting the chip in his skull and brain, Arbaugh has gained the remarkable ability to move a cursor solely through the power of thought.

Of course, this kind of technology comes with its share of risks. Yet, for individuals like Arbaugh, the potential rewards are transformative. The chance to regain some measure of independence and enrich their lives in ways previously thought impossible is nothing short of groundbreaking. Arbaugh’s device translates his neural impulses into digital commands, allowing him to engage with technology in unprecedented ways.

Never one to shy away from the limelight, Arbaugh recently discussed his experience on the Joe Rogan Experience, the go-to platform for all things Musk-related. It’s here he revealed a surprising perk of his neural upgrade: enhanced gaming skills. Describing his newfound abilities, Arbaugh likened it to having an “aimbot” in his head – a term gamers use to refer to software that automatically targets opponents with superhuman precision. He spoke of the chip’s accuracy and speed, noting that sometimes it feels as though the cursor moves even before he consciously decides to move it.

Despite these advancements, Arbaugh admitted that his new skills have their limitations. While he’s yet to conquer action-packed games like Call of Duty, he has successfully navigated virtual worlds in titles such as Civilization VI and Mario Kart. Arbaugh remains optimistic, believing that within a few years, his neural-linked gaming abilities will be on par with those of any other player. His ultimate goal? To one day master Halo, a game synonymous with skillful gameplay and intense competition.

However, the road to this digital utopia isn’t without its bumps. Arbaugh’s journey with Neuralink hasn’t been an entirely smooth experience. Earlier this year, he faced setbacks, losing control of the cursor at times, as he shared with Bloomberg.
